We are very excited at Cake Marketing to be part of this special Lismore event, The Stella Network presents JODIE FOX from Shoes of Prey and Sneaking Duck. Jodie Fox is now co-founder of and manages communications for Shoes of Prey and Sneaking Duck. Jodie went to school in Lismore and studied law and international business at Griffith University in QLD. After co-founding multi-million dollar global enterprise Shoes of Prey, an online custom design shoe company with Michael Knapp and Michael Fox in 2009, the team were joined by Mark Capps to co-found Sneaking Duck, a fashion glasses online store, in October...
